This looks to me like JDK crash. In general the first step with any crash is to locate the fatal error log. This is a text file that the HotSpot VM generates in the event of a crash. By default the file name is hs_err_pid <pid> .log, where pid is the process ID of the process. The system attempts to create the file in the working directory of the process. In the event that the file cannot be created in the working directory (insufficient space, permission problem, or other issue), the file is created in the temporary directory for the operating system. On Solaris OS and Linux the temporary directory is /tmp. On Windows the temporary directory is specified by the value of the TMP environment variable; if that environment variable is not defined, the value of the TEMP environment variable is used. Once you locate the fatal error log, please attach it to this bug. |
